On May 30, amid the vibrant atmosphere of the opening night of the Da Nang International Fireworks Festival (DIFF 2026), the renowned French bakery brand Eric Kayser officially welcomed its first guests at Sun World Ba Na Hills.

From early morning, the atmosphere at the French Village became more lively than ever. Large numbers of domestic and international visitors, after enjoying the cable car ride and checking in at the iconic Golden Bridge, eagerly gathered in the heart of the French Village to witness the grand opening.

Guests were delighted by the lively yet artistic performances of international dancers in the “Jum Jum Show”, which provided an impressive prelude to the opening ceremony of the second Eric Kayser bakery in Vietnam and the first-ever Maison Kayser bakery at Ba Na Hills.

Located in a prime position within the French Village, the bakery immediately captures attention with a design inspired by the elegance and timeless charm of a classic Parisian bakery. One of its distinctive features is its six open façades, offering panoramic views of surrounding castles, historic churches and romantic French-style architecture.

With a capacity of up to 300 seats, the bakery’s sophisticated interior harmoniously blends with the French Village’s historic ambiance and the cool climate of Ba Na’s mountaintop setting, creating what feels like a genuine “corner of Paris” in central Vietnam.

During the opening ceremony, many visitors eagerly sampled Eric Kayser’s signature pastries, including the classic Croissant, known for its golden, flaky exterior and rich buttery layers, and the Pain au Chocolat, featuring freshly baked pastry wrapped around delicate bittersweet chocolate.
“I’m a huge fan of croissants, but the croissants at Eric Kayser Ba Na are truly different. They are not only delicious, with a perfectly crispy crust, but also incredibly soft, chewy and buttery inside—unlike any croissant I’ve had before,” said Hanh Hanh, a visitor from Hanoi.

One of the most distinctive interactive experiences at Maison Kayser Ba Na Hills is the opportunity for guests to personally select their pastries, observe bakers kneading dough, shaping and baking products on-site, and leave their impressions on the bakery’s signature message wall.
